1binni9

  • 홈
  • 태그
  • 방명록

2025/04/16 1

Unity game reversing - libil2cpp.so

제목에서 언급한 파일은 unity 게임에서 무빙 및 HP/MP 와 같은 데이터 메모리가 있는 바이너리 파일이다.Unity에서 사용하는 언어는 주로 C#인데, li2cpp는 C#코드를 IL코드로 변환한 후 빌드할 플렛폼에 맞는 Assembly로 변환하여 실행한 기기에서 동작한다.* Unity : 주로 저사양 소규모 모바일 게임(2D)을 제작하는 데 널리 쓰이는 게임 엔진. 3D 그래픽을 채용하는 게임의 경우 언리얼 엔진이 주력이다.파일을 해석할 때는 디스어셈블러를 이용하여 ARM 아키텍쳐로 구성된 어셈블리어를 해석한다. 메타 데이터가 담긴 global-metadata.dat 파일을 적용하면 libil2cpp.so 에서 나타내는 메모리 주소에 대해 파악할 수 있다. 그러기 위하여 libil2cpp.so 와 ..

카테고리 없음 2025.04.16
이전
1
다음
더보기
프로필사진

1binni9

Dept. of Cyber Security

  • 분류 전체보기 (16)
    • 스터디 (7)
    • Forensic (2)

Tag

CFB, OFB, 현대암호이론, CTR, 네트워크보안, 드림핵 #포렌식, 블록암호, cbc, forensic, feistel, AES,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2025/04   »
일 월 화 수 목 금 토
1 2 3 4 5
6 7 8 9 10 11 12
13 14 15 16 17 18 19
20 21 22 23 24 25 26
27 28 29 30

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바